They are generally best as supplemental heat sources, not primary ones, and they do require electricity to run the heater. The flame effect is purely decorative and uses minimal power. We can discuss how to best utilize your unit for efficient heating in your Virginia home.
The flame effect uses very little electricity, similar to a light bulb. The heater uses more, comparable to a space heater, but it's designed for efficient zonal heating. For homes in Portsmouth, they offer a convenient way to add warmth and ambiance.
